#3b3238 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b3238 is composed of 23.1% red, 19.6%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.3%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 320 degrees, a saturation of 8.3% and a lightness of 21.4%. #3b3238 color hex could be obtained by blending #766470 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#3b3238

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060506 is the darkest color, while #fbfaf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b3238

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373637 is the less saturated color, while #690447 is the most saturated one.
